A: flash_all_lock.bat will flash the ROM and re-lock your bootloader . Only use this if you are certain you want the bootloader locked again, as you may need to unlock it again later for any future modifications. It's generally recommended to use flash_all.bat (keep unlocked) unless you have a specific reason not to.

Sometimes, decompression software like WinRAR glitches during the extraction of heavy .tgz files, resulting in missing files or a broken .bat script. Download and install the free tool . Right-click your downloaded .tgz or .tar ROM file. Select 7-Zip > Extract Here .
